Cleaning a pool table cloth is a straightforward process, but its one that demands attention to detail. The process typically involves a few key steps, which, when followed diligently, can significantly extend the life of your table's playing surface. Begin by brushing the cushions and cloth in a single, consistent direction from the top to the bottom of the table. This motion helps to dislodge any debris that has settled on the surface. Following the brushing, use a vacuum cleaner to remove the loosened particles. Finally, complete the cleaning process by wiping the cushions and cloth with a damp microfiber towel. This final step helps to pick up any remaining dust or residue, leaving the cloth clean and ready for your next game.

To effectively clean the cloth, start by using a special pool table brush to sweep the debris from the bumper rails onto the table. Then, direct the brush toward the center of the table, sweeping away any lint or debris from the edges and around the pockets. It's crucial to maintain a straight motion with your sweep, as circular motions can spread the debris rather than collecting it. These simple actions can make a big difference in the overall cleanliness of your table. A pool table brush is specifically designed to clean pool table felt. It features one end with longer bristles to reach under the rails and soft bristles to prevent damage to the felt.

One of the most effective tools for pool table maintenance is the pool table brush. It is important to use a brush that is specifically designed for pool tables because the pool table felt is very fine. Start cleaning by using the special pool table brush, which is made with both longer and soft bristles. The soft bristles prevent damage to the felt, while the longer bristles assist in removing debris that may be hidden in hard-to-reach areas like under the rails. It is recommended to brush the pool table after a play day.
